Android 启动图标不适用于 .png 图像,但适用于 .jpeg

Posted

技术标签:

【中文标题】Android 启动图标不适用于 .png 图像,但适用于 .jpeg【英文标题】:Android Launch Icon doesn't work with .png image but works with .jpeg 【发布时间】:2019-05-16 03:36:06 【问题描述】:

我花了几个小时尝试将 png 图像上传为 App Launch Icon,但没有成功。清理、重新启动、手动将 png 文件添加到文件夹并没有帮助。 只有在我将 png 更改为 jpeg 后,问题才得到解决。

有人知道为什么会这样吗?

【问题讨论】:

“问题”到底是什么? “不工作”在调试时几乎没用。 构建android智能手机后看不到png图标,它只显示标准的android图标。仅使用 jpeg 问题就消失了。 【参考方案1】:

没有详细信息,但你可以去this link 和:

点击图片标签 插入您的图片并选择所有功能 下载 替换所有图像格式(xxhdpi、hdpi、...) drawable-xxhdpi, drawable xhdpi,... 和 mipmap-xxhdpi, mipmap-xhdpi,... 文件夹。 在AndroidManifest.xml中设置android:icon = "@drawable/myicon"

图像的格式(png 或 jpeg)与问题无关。

【讨论】:

以上是关于Android 启动图标不适用于 .png 图像,但适用于 .jpeg的主要内容,如果未能解决你的问题,请参考以下文章

png中的图标用于底部导航栏android

Android 启动画面不适用于 Cordova 5.0.0

使用 PHP GD lib 压缩和调整图像大小不适用于 png 和 jpg 的奇怪结果

<v-img> 不适用于静态图像。 [Vuetify] 图片加载失败 src:@/assets/img/logo.png

Android Studio 启动器图标 - 必须设置图标名称

TabbedPage 选项卡图标不适用于字体真棒